Jeez, my mistake again, I mixed up the two cases in the description:
- Change user name in lock file: this will behave as expected, dialog comes to
front,
- Change profile location in lock file: this will not, dialog stays in
background (in this case the dialog shows "Open" instead of "Open Copy" in the
middle).

Let me write down my steps correctly this time, all this has to be repeated
with the same LO installation:
1. Save an empty document.
2. Copy and edit its lock file by changing profile location (last entry),
3. Close document, copy back the lock file.
4. Start a new document, I did from command line (to have an LO window open).
5. From command line, open the existing document by giving it as parameter to
soffice.

=> The dialog doesn't show in front.

If it does, cancel out, go back to command line and try again step 5.

Mind you, the behavior can be different with slightly different steps. I used
to test by opening an existing document instead of an empty one in step 4. Then
it mattered if you just canceled out of the dialog, or also alt-tabbed back to
the previously open document, or clicked back into the previously open
document. Then the bug was only reproducible with the 3rd variant.
However, with an empty document this doesn't seem to matter... strange (it
seems the complications of steps started in 6.0, possibly by Caolan's change).

It's easy to get confused by all these tiny details that matter here...

--- Comment #5 from Caolán McNamara  ---
This is set as "Inherited from OOo" and marked as a regression at the same time
which seems a bit contradictory. 

Are the screenshots from a recent master ?, what I think I expect to see at
this moment in master is that the blank window which will become the new
document should appear first when there is a warning dialog, i.e. that the
warning dialog is a child of that new document window , rather than what seems
to be the case here that the warning dialog is a child of a previous document
window, and in that case I'd hope that the new document window would already be
"at-front" along with its modal blocking warning dialog.

--- Comment #4 from V Stuart Foote  ---
This class of helper dialog ("Document in use" dialog here and the "Enter
Password" dialog as in bug 49134) do not seem to get the same ToTop for a
document frame (LoadEnv::impl_makeFrameWindowVisible) as Mark H. did for bug
48300 [1]

Can the dialogs be handled in a similar fashion to force focus and ToTop?
